Odisha police on Thursday suspended inspector-in-charge (IIC) of Kegaon police station, Damu Paraja for dereliction of duty in connection with the murder case of lady teacher Mamita Meher that has triggered a political storm in the State.
“Paraja has been suspended for dereliction of duty in the murder of the lady teacher at Sunshine English Medium School at Mahaling in Kalahandi,” said Kalahandi SP Saravana Vivek.
